Scoping Studies to Develop a UK Policy Programme which supports Financial Reform in China Theme 2: Asset Management

• Identify and understand key barriers to global asset diversification faced by Chinese asset managers who look to do so, potential barriers may include but not limited to: asset class, market knowledge, return differentials, regulation, government support, international partners, arrangement of mutual recognition of funds; • Explore whether ‘special zone’ arrangement in China (e.g. the Shanghai Free Trade Zone), could support Chinese asset managers in diversifying their portfolios into overseas assets, and how; • Intelligence on what knowledge/tools/skills Chinese asset managers need to “…
